- [ ] Before the Quillhaven signing ceremony proceeds, run the leaked-file-descriptor hunt on the offline signer. As a new contractor, please be thorough: enumerate every open descriptor on the sealed host, confirm nothing points at the ceremony scratch volume, and log each finding in the Larkspur register. If any descriptor traces back to the retired Fenwick exporter, halt and page the ceremony lead. Once the host shows a clean descriptor table, unlock the escrow envelope using the phrase below.

unlock words, yajof-tagef: aldiel-kasath-briax-fraeth-pelius-olieth-pelix-wenius-wenael-norael

TICKET-4412: Cron drift on scheduler nodes (Parnell cluster)

While investigating why the nightly rollup in Quillhaven ran 40 minutes late, we found the staging scheduler was reading the wrong env file. The host had been cloned from a decommissioned box, so chrony was pointed at a retired time source and jobs drifted steadily. Fix: repoint chrony, then recreate /etc/quillhaven/scheduler.env from the template. Note for future maintainers: the rollup worker also needs its signing credential in that file, on the line directly below this note.

sealed setting: ARCHIVE_KEY3=8d0

Release steps for the Brightmoor reset-flow revamp: flip `reset_v2` to 10%, watch token-validation errors for 20 minutes, then ramp to 100%. Old flow stays warm for 48 hours. Rollback is flag-off only — no redeploy needed. Metrics, flag history, and abort criteria are on the page below.

wiki page, tahaf-tajog: https://jira.ordindyn.corp/pipeline

Handover — dispatch desk. Taking over the Ryecroft trial plot job: four sealed seed boxes from Lanthorn Seedworks, staged at the cold room, paperwork clipped to box one. Pickup window is 07:45–08:15; driver already briefed on the gate code procedure. Nothing else pending on this run. Read the courier the instruction below at hand-over.

dispatch memo: the eliok quenok courier leaves the sorael aldath belion tammir casix gileth queniel jorath ledger at gate 9299 under passcode 897989

## Break-Glass: Bellrow Timetable Solver

If the Bellrow solver hangs during term-start scheduling at a customer school, support may invoke break-glass to restart the job queue directly. Notify the duty lead first; all actions are audited. Open the emergency console and authenticate with the recovery passphrase below.

unlock words, yawig-kagef: gordor-holvan-ulaael-pramir-ulaiel-tamdor